The Benefits of an Online Mental Health Assessment

A mental health assessment is a wonderful way for therapists to diagnose their clients. This will give them the necessary information to design a successful treatment plan. This will allow them to monitor the progress of a client between sessions.

Participants displaying depressive symptoms completed an extensive online psychiatric evaluation that included individualized psychoeducation and help-seeking recommendations. The results revealed that online assessments can enhance personal outcomes and help people find the appropriate type of clinical support.

Assessments

Online assessments of mental health are an excellent method to determine if you are suffering from mental illness and discover treatment options. These tools are simple to use and can help determine if your symptoms are due to a mental illness that can be treated such as depression or anxiety. In only a few minutes you can conduct a comprehensive online psychological assessment. It's an excellent alternative to traditional psychological assessments in person which can be expensive and time-consuming. These assessment tools online are used to test for depression, anxiety, and other disorders. They can also help you make an educated decision about the best treatment option for your situation.

These assessments allow therapists also to monitor the progress of their clients as well as assess their health. These data are invaluable for their practice and help them design targeted interventions and encourage client engagement. The digital format of these assessments also allows for standard data collection, which could reduce errors and improve efficiency. These assessments can also be integrated with existing systems, such as electronic health records (EHRs) and practice management software.

Despite the growing popularity of these assessments, they have some limitations. For How Much Is A Mental Health Assessment instance, they may not be able to accurately identify a mental disorder or predict when a person will seek assistance. They also do not necessarily reflect the experiences of all people. Finally, there is the risk of misdiagnosis and over-treatment.

Reports

Clinicians utilize psychiatric assessment tools to determine the presence of symptoms and the root causes of mental disorders. They usually include questionnaires and interviews that evaluate the severity, frequency of, frequency, and duration of a wide spectrum of symptoms. These instruments are based on a specific classification system and they only cover the most common symptoms. This can result in an inconsistency in diagnosis and hinder research on the root cause of mental illness.

Online assessment tools have altered the landscape of psychiatric diagnosis and assessment. These tools are designed to collect information and present a report of the results of the user in just a few minutes. They also allow the user to a local, high-quality treatment provider. They can also help the user to track their progress and keep track of changes in symptoms.

While self-assessments on the internet can be a great way to detect certain symptoms however, they cannot substitute the need for a thorough examination by an experienced mental health professional. They can even cause a misdiagnosis, since the results of the assessments are often misleading if they are not taken into consideration with other factors, including the patient's history and previous life events.

The use of different assessment instruments by different clinicians could also cause confusion in the diagnosis because these instruments are usually restricted to a handful of symptoms and may not be able to cover all aspects of a disease's appearance. This is especially important when it comes to the atypical mental health diagnosis assessment illness manifestations, which are more prevalent in older individuals and frequently exhibit symptoms that overlap with other illnesses.

Fortunately, technology is helping to reduce the barriers to accessing care for mental illness and is bringing it to more people than ever before. The use of assessment tools that are digital is rapidly expanding as more healthcare professionals realize the potential for these cutting-edge and powerful tools to enhance access to psychiatric services for patients. Digital tools are also more efficient, convenient, and economical, and have larger capacity for data collection. They also cut down on the time required for clinical assessments.

The most common treatments for mental illnesses are psychotherapy and psychiatric medications. These treatments can be utilized as a pair or in combination. Psychotherapy, also known as talk therapy, assists people who have a variety of problems, including anxiety and depression. The treatments can be individual in that the person is the only one in the room with a therapist, or they may be group therapy. Group therapy is a frequent gathering of a limited number of patients to discuss the issues they are facing. It can be very helpful to be aware that others suffer from similar problems and listen to their stories.

Other treatments include cognitive behavior therapy, interpersonal psychotherapy, and psychotherapy for families. CBT and IPT help people change their patterns of thinking, behavior and relationships. They can teach people how to request a mental health assessment to manage stress and improve coping skills. Family therapy is an excellent method to support family members deal with issues and build healthy relationship.

Some individuals experience such serious mental health issues that they need to receive medical treatment in a hospital or treatment program. This type of treatment is temporary and designed to stabilize a patient. It is a great option for people who are suicidal or fearful of harming themselves.

A comprehensive psychiatric examination includes a physical exam, an interview with family members and the patient, and a discussion of the symptoms. The evaluation also includes a review of the patient's medical history and medication. It is crucial to answer all questions honestly and accurately in order to ensure a correct diagnosis is made. While a psychiatrist is able to make a diagnosis from the symptoms by itself, it is important to look at other factors, such as the lifestyle and the environment.

Multiple studies have shown internet-based interventions are cost-effective for mental disorders (Baumann, Donker, and Ophuis 2017). However the studies have restricted their economic evaluations to a societal perspective and failed to distinguish between the costs of the system and those of the patient. This gap in knowledge limits the capacity of policymakers to provide information on the cost-effectiveness of digital mental health interventions.

Telepsychiatry is becoming more sought-after and cost-effective. Some providers offer low prices for future visits, while other offer a discounted price for patients with insurance. On their websites, the majority of telepsychiatry services list the insurance plans that they accept. If your insurance plan doesn't cover telepsychiatry, consider other payment options, such as the HSA or FSA.
